The brand-new Maslina Resort, a chic, five-star, Relais & Chateaux property on the Croatian island of Hvar, is delighted to announce the addition of their new luxury boat. The customised Colnago 45 TS will transport guests directly from Split Airport over the crystal-clear waters of the Adriatic Sea to the luxurious boutique property within one hour.

Built by Hvar natives, the Colnago family, who have a long-standing tradition in designing and building luxury boats for use between the Croatian islands and the mainland, Maslina Resort commissioned the bespoke vessel, designed entirely with these unique islands in mind. The result is the beautifully created, modern take on vintage luxury Colnago 45 TS, which is aligned with the design aesthetics of Maslina Resort. Measuring 11.95 metres, the prominent lines of the boat signify less resistance to air and higher performance and is perfectly crafted with the utmost attention to the comfort of guests. The Colnago 45 TS seats up to 12 guests and two crew.

The new addition of the custom-made boat will enhance the guest experience. Guests will no longer have to drive to the port of Split and wait for the public ferry or catamaran, which can take up to two hours to reach Hvar. The Colnago 45 TS will enable guests of Maslina Resort to travel to the property directly, within an hour, seamlessly and in style! With staff taking care of the check-in process on-board, guests can enjoy the cruise across the sparkling waters of the Adriatic Sea and immediately begin to enjoy the facilities at Maslina Resort the moment they step ashore.
